The space was created with two textures by proverbialsunrise and a plain black layer onto which I used HSV noise to create "stars".

They were standing next to each other, so I made an icon out of that! It's pretty simple – just the two of them, masked off from their original background and then some adjustment of levels done so that there's a better range of values from light to dark. That made their hair look a bit too matte and made Zhao Yunlan's t-shirt blow up, however, so I did some nondestructive dodge/burning to darken Zhao Yunlan's tee and Shen Wei's coat, as well as bring back the highlights and thus sense of depth for the hair. The background is just a black layer with HSV noise. Though I'd quibble with a few of your examples, I'd agree that Guardian at least matches the science fantasy of Star Wars and things like the Marvel movies and various superhero television shows, which is how I usually think of it. I do think, though, they had an extra challenge in the necessity of adapting a fantasy source to will-pass-the-censors science fiction, and certain elements translated better than others. That's just the nature of the beast, and I think they recognized that and, like the central romance, I think it's an area of the drama where there are points at which they deliberately edge right up to that line. Not because they can't insert skiencebabble just as well as anyone else in the business, but because they geared the drama to both an audience unfamiliar with the novel and an audience familiar with it, and they dropped Easter eggs in for those familiar with it.
